Here’s the takeaway: AMZN’s price action, options flow, and fundamentals all point to a high-probability upside breakout. The stock is sitting at a technical inflection point—either it holds above $228.48 (Bollinger Band middle) or faces a short-term pullback. But the options market is clearly pricing in a bullish outcome, especially with AI and AWS momentum accelerating. Let’s break down why this setup matters for traders today.
Bullish Imbalance in Options and What It MeansThe options chain tells a story of conviction. For this Friday’s expirations, calls at $235 (OI: 26,404) and $240 (OI: 17,785) dominate, while puts at $222.5 (OI: 9,451) and $225 (OI: 9,388) offer limited downside protection. The next Friday chain amplifies this trend, with $250 calls (OI: 13,829) and $240 calls (OI: 13,152) as top contenders. This suggests institutional players are hedging for a rally above $235, not a crash below $220.
Block trades reinforce this. The 2026-01-16 $250 call (
) was bought in bulk (500 contracts), signaling a bet on AI-driven growth. Meanwhile, deep puts like the 2026-01-16 $230 put () show some hedging, but the overall ratio still favors bulls. The risk? If dips below $222.25 (30-day support), that call-heavy positioning could trigger a short-term profit-taking selloff.News Flow and Market Sentiment AlignmentRecent headlines validate the bullish case. Citi’s $320 price target and a DCF model valuing AMZN at $305 (vs. current $231) highlight undervaluation. AWS’s 20.2% revenue growth and $125B 2025 capex for AI infrastructure are concrete catalysts. Even insider sales (like CEO Garman’s shares) haven’t dented institutional confidence—Dynamic Advisor Solutions just boosted its AMZN stake by 2.5%.
But here’s the catch: The RSI at 40.3 suggests the stock isn’t overbought yet, giving it room to run. However, if AI capex fears or labor issues resurface, the $221–$222 support zone (lower Bollinger Band and 200D MA) becomes critical. Retail traders should watch whether the stock holds above that level—breaking below it would invalidate the bullish case.
